The best time to visit Franz Josef is between December and February, during the summer months in New Zealand. During this period, the weather is warmer, and conditions are ideal for hiking, glacier tours, and outdoor activities. However, spring (September to November) and autumn (March to May) can also offer mild weather and fewer crowds, making them excellent alternatives for a visit.
Franz Josef is generally considered safe for tourists, but there are some risks to be aware of. The glacier area is subject to changing weather conditions and natural hazards, such as ice falls or flooding. Visitors are encouraged to follow all safety guidelines, stay on designated paths, and consider guided tours for added safety. Always check local conditions before visiting.

Getting around in Franz Josef is relatively straightforward due to its small size. Most attractions and services are within walking distance. For exploring further afield, here are some options:
- Walking: Many local attractions, cafes, and accommodations are easily accessible on foot.
- Biking: Bicycle rentals are available and are a great way to explore the area at your own pace.
- Shuttle Services: Some tour operators and accommodations offer shuttle services to popular destinations like the glacier base.
- Guided Tours: Many guided tours provide transportation as part of their services.
- Car Rental: Renting a car is a convenient way to explore nearby parks and scenic routes at your leisure.
If you need more information, local visitor centers can provide details on transportation options and recommendations.

The cost of a 3-day trip in Franz Josef can vary depending on your preferences and activities. On average, you can expect to spend:
- Accommodation: Budget accommodations may cost around $30-$50 NZD per night. Mid-range options typically range between $100-$200 NZD per night, while premium stays can go beyond $300 NZD per night.
- Food and Drinks: Meals at budget restaurants may cost $15-$25 NZD per person, while mid-range dining options may cost $30-$50 NZD per person.
- Activities: Glacier tours can range from $300-$500 NZD, while hiking or free activities may not add extra costs.
- Transport: Renting a car may cost around $60-$120 NZD per day, depending on the vehicle type, while shared shuttles are generally more affordable.
Overall, a budget trip could cost around $400-$600 NZD, while a more luxurious experience may range between $1000-$1500 NZD for 3 days.
